What is the Nutritional Value of Cake Batter Explosion Ice Cream?

Cake Batter Explosion Ice Cream is not a Nutritionally balanced food and lacks many of the essential nutrients our bodies need to function properly. However, it does contain some vitamins and minerals from the Ingredients used to make it. One scoop of this dessert typically contains around 150 Calories, 7 grams of fat, 20 grams of carbohydrates, 15 grams of Sugar, and 2 grams of protein. While it may be a tasty treat, it's important to remember that it's not a Healthy or nutrient-dense food.

Nutritional Values of 1/2 cup (66 g) Cake Batter Explosion Ice Cream

UnitValue
Calories (kcal)150 kcal
Fat (g)7 g
Carbs (g)20 g
Protein (g)2 g

Calorie breakdown: 42% fat, 53% carbs, 5% protein
